Subject: DR drill notice — Graphloom visualizer

Support team: on Monday we run a disaster-recovery drill for Graphloom, our dependency graph visualizer. Expect the staging instance to go dark for roughly an hour while we restore graph snapshots and re-index edges. Customer-facing service is unaffected. If you assist with the restore console, you will be prompted for the recovery passphrase below.

unlock words, tawif-tahop: oliys-ulawyn-tamdor-lamys-casox-jormir-fraius-kasath-ulador-ulamir-holir-sorys-holeth

Quarterly Planning Note — Hollins Creek Franchise

Welcome aboard! Quick context before your first week: the franchise agreement with Bramblefield Eats renews this quarter, and they're pushing for wider territory rights around Hollins Creek. Legal says our position is solid, but Marta wants it settled before the trade fair. One more thing you should know before the kickoff.

confidential, fahip-bagep: The southern region missed its Holwyn quota by 21.5 percent last quarter. Sorvanek Foods plans to raise the Jorir list price by 23.9 percent in December. The pricing group signed off on a budget of $411.6 million for Project Eliion. The renewal with Juldorix Works closes at $87.9 million a year, 16.8 percent below the last contract.

TURN-208: Gatevale turnstile counters at the Merrow Field pilot double-count when a rotation reverses mid-cycle. Attendance totals drift roughly 2% high per event. The debounce window fix is implemented, reviewed by Ilsa, and soak-tested across two simulated match days without drift. Ready for your cut; the candidate build is identified below.

trace token, tagag-tafog: htk6_5ed18c

Minutes — Management Meeting, Marketing Budget Reduction

Attendees reviewed the proposed 15% reduction to the Seldane campaign budget. Finance confirmed the saving offsets the Torvey warehouse overrun. Marketing will retain the loyalty program but suspend print media through year-end. Action: finance to reissue the quarterly forecast by next Thursday. The chair closed by summarizing the confidential rationale, recorded below.

board note of bawep-tajef: Queniusek Systems plans to raise the Quenvan list price by 53.1 percent in March. The pricing group signed off on a budget of $176.4 million for Project Drueth. The renewal with Casionix Partners closes at $142.5 million a year, 8.3 percent below the last contract. Project Fraax slips by six weeks because of the tooling delay.